Microsoft Corporation, multinational technology corporation that manufactures computer software, consumer electronics, personal computers, and related services has been working effortlessly over the years to give its user the best experience.
On Tuesday, Microsoft took to the virtual stage as it unveiled a series of new features for Windows 11 that are intended to meet the needs of people who work in a hybrid environment.

During the pandemic, the switch to working from home prompted a revolution in the demand for personal computers. Currently, Microsoft is hoping that a gradual return to the office will help to boost the sales of its most recent operating system.

Panos Panay, Chief product officer explained in an interview that “ the idea is to help companies be more agile and flexible for their employees and themselves”

What You Need To Know About Windows 11 New Features

Windows 11 is intended to bring users closer to the things they enjoy doing.
Windows for more than 10% of Microsoft’s revenue has become more popular as a result of the pandemic, as people stayed at home and spent more time on their computers for school, work, and recreation.

The simplification of the Windows user interface, the introduction of a new Windows Store, as well as improvements in performance and multitasking, are the primary focus of Windows 11. In addition, for the first time, Windows 11 will include support for running Android applications.

Updates on Windows 365

In 2021, Microsoft introduced Windows 365 as a way for employees to access cloud-based PCs from anywhere. Three new features will be added to the service, according to the announcement made on April 5th.

The first of them, Windows 365 Boot, allows you to connect to your Cloud PC every time you power on your device. That’s a step forward over the existing approach, which requires you to first log in to your normal desktop. However, owing to a new Task Switcher, switching between the two will be much simpler. In principle, this should make switching between open windows as straightforward as switching between open windows. The most important new feature, though, is Windows 365 Offline, which allows you to continue working on your Cloud PC even if your internet connection goes down. Once the connection is restored, the changes will be preserved.

It’s unclear when these capabilities will be introduced to Windows 365, or if they’ll be accessible to all subscriptions. Microsoft also revealed a series of new enterprise-focused improvements.

Additional Windows 11 Features

Furthermore, on Tuesday include enhanced phishing protection. Defender SmartScreen detects and warns users who enter their Microsoft login credentials into a compromised website or harmful software.

Smart App Control stops untrusted applications from running. Personal data encryption safeguards data kept on a device even when the user is not signed in. That makes recovering sensitive data from a lost or stolen device more difficult.

Windows 365 boot, which allows users to connect straight into a cloud PC, is one of the features targeted at bridging the gap between the virtual and physical worlds.

 

Other Window 11 New features expected include

  • New design and Start menu at the center
  • Windows 11 will support Android apps
  • Windows 11 Snap Layouts and Snap Groups
  • Microsoft brings Xbox features to Windows
  • Microsoft Integrates Teams in Windows 11
  • Windows 11 Widgets
